Implant failure can occur for various reasons. One common issue is infection, often arising from poor oral hygiene. Peri-implantitis, a selected kind of gum disease affecting the delicate and hard tissues surrounding the implant, can lead to significant bone loss and, ultimately, failure of the implant.

Misalignment throughout implantation also can lead to issues. If an implant isn't positioned appropriately, it may expertise undue stress or strain when chewing. This misalignment can lead to implant failure or make it more likely for the encircling teeth to suffer from wear or damage.

When a dental implant fails, the patient's quick concern typically revolves round what may be accomplished subsequent. Fortunately, dental implants can typically get replaced in the event that they fail. However, the process just isn't as easy as simply inserting a brand new implant in the identical spot.

Before replacing a failed implant, a comprehensive analysis is needed to establish the underlying cause of the failure. Addressing these points is essential to ensuring a profitable replacement. If infection was an element, the dental skilled will want to clear it up, which may involve therapies for peri-implantitis or bettering oral hygiene practices.


Should bone density be an issue, additional procedures could be required. Bone grafting could be necessary to rebuild the jawbone, offering a sturdy foundation for the model new implant. This further procedure can add time to the general remedy plan, however it's often essential for long-term success.

Once the site has healed, and any underlying points have been treated, the replacement of the dental implant can proceed. The process of inserting a new implant typically follows the identical steps as the original placement, with careful attention to alignment and positioning to keep away from earlier errors.


While most people can obtain a replacement implant, there are some considerations that a dental skilled must consider. For example, the patient’s general health, habits, and oral hygiene become extra important components after experiencing a failure. More strong screening will often happen to ensure all potential risks are mitigated.

What are the frequent reasons for dental implant failure?undefinedDental implant failure can happen because of numerous factors, including infection, inadequate bone density, improper placement, or extreme stress on the implant. Understanding these causes can help prevent potential issues.


How can I inform if my dental implant has failed?undefinedSigns of dental implant failure embody pain, swelling, loose implants, or infection. If you expertise any of those signs, it is essential to seek the advice of your dentist promptly.


Is it secure to switch a failed dental implant?undefinedYes, changing a failed dental implant is mostly protected. However, your dentist will assess the cause for the failure and might have to handle underlying points before proceeding with implantation.

What is the success rate of replacing a dental implant?undefinedThe success rate for replacing a dental implant is similar to that of the initial placement, usually round 90-95%, provided that correct protocols are adopted and potential points are addressed.


How long does it take to switch a failed dental implant?undefinedThe timeline for changing a failed dental implant can differ, however it sometimes takes a quantity of months from removing to placement of a brand new implant, permitting for healing and bone preparation.
